UTLEIEMEGLEREN FOLLO AS is registered as a limited company in Nordre Follo, Akershus with organisation number 933864545. The business is classified under intermediation service activities for real estate activities (NACE 68.310). The company was incorporated in 2024. Registered share capital is NOK 500,000, divided into 100 shares. The company's stated purpose is: “Formidling av utleieleiligheter, eiendomsmegling, forretningsførsel, samt annet der naturlig hører inn under virksomheten.”.
